Neutralization and Binding Profile of Monoclonal Antibodies Generated Against Influenza A H1N1 Viruses

摘要

Monoclonal antibodies (MAbs) provide scope for the development of better therapeutics and diagnostic tools. Herein, we describe the binding and neutralization profile(s) for a panel of murine MAbs generated against influenza A H1N1 viruses elicited by immunization with pandemic H1 recombinant hemagglutinin (rHA)/whole virus or seasonal H1 rHA. Neutralizing MAbs, MA-2070 and MA-M, were obtained after pandemic A/California/ 07/2009 (H1N1) virus/rHA immunization(s). Both MAbs reacted specifically with rHA from A/California/07/ 2009 and A/England/195/2009 in ELISA. MA-2070 bound rHA of A/California/07/2009 with high affinity (K_D = 51.36±9.20nM) and exhibited potent in vitro neutralization (IC_50 = 2.50μg/mL). MA-2070 bound within the stem domain of HA. MA-M exhibited both hemagglutination inhibition (HI, 1.50μg/mL) and in vitro neutralization (IC_50 = 0.66 μg/mL) activity against the pandemic A/California/07/2009 virus and showed higher binding affinity (K_D = 9.80±0.67 nM) than MA-2070. MAb, MA-H generated against the seasonal A/Solomon Islands/03/2006 (H1N1) rHA binds within the head domain and bound the seasonal H1N1 (A/Solomon Islands/03/ 2006 and A/New Caledonia/20/1990) rHAs with high affinity (K_D; 0.72-8.23 nM). MA-H showed high HI (2.50μg/mL) and in vitro neutralization (IC_50 = 2.61μg/mL) activity against the A/Solomon Islands/03/2006 virus. All 3 MAbs failed to react in ELISA with rHA from various strains of H2N2, H3N2, H5N1, H7N9, and influenza virus B, suggesting their specificity for either pandemic or seasonal H1N1 influenza virus. The MAbs reported here may be useful in developing diagnostic assays.
